Career path

Career Role (Problem Solving & Math Skills) Description
Data Scientist (Advanced Analytics) Extract insights from complex datasets; employ advanced statistical modeling. High demand in finance, tech.
Financial Analyst (Quantitative Finance) Analyze financial markets; build quantitative models for investment decisions. Strong mathematical foundations are essential.
Actuary (Risk Management) Assess and manage financial risks using statistical methods and probability. Requires proficiency in mathematical modeling.
Operational Research Analyst (Optimization) Develop and implement mathematical models to improve efficiency and decision-making in organizations. Problem-solving is key.
Machine Learning Engineer (Algorithmic Problem Solving) Develop and deploy machine learning algorithms; requires strong mathematical and programming skills. High growth sector.
